Decoding Gendered Apparel: A Look at Modern Trends
Modern fashion trends are constantly evolving, blurring the boundaries between traditionally guy's and ladylike attire. What was once strictly defined by gender is now a fluid landscape where individuals showcase their personal aesthetic without limitations. This transformation can be noticed in the rising popularity of unisex clothing, where outfits transcend traditional notions of being a man and womanliness. This evolution is driven by a desire for greater representation in the fashion world, allowing people to express themselves authentically.
Yet, the influence of traditional gender norms persists in some aspects of the industry. Marketing often still separates clothing by gender, and societal beliefs can frequently lead to judgments against individuals who question these standards. Despite these obstacles, the shift towards more inclusive and gender-fluid fashion is undeniable.
